My Homeschool Schedule for Multiple Grades This can be done by scheduling different subjects at different times of the day or dividing the day into blocks where each child works on one subject at a time.Ī mixture of the two ideas is what has worked for my family over the years. On the other hand, it can be difficult to keep everyone on task with so many different ages and interests, and to cover all of the subjects needed at each level.Īnother option is to stagger the school day so that each child has individual attention.

On one hand, the children can learn from each other and enjoy group activities. One option is to school all the children together. When considering homeschooling children in multiple grades, there are a couple of options to choose from.
